I use crumpled (plain white) paper, paper towels, packing paper, cut up toilet paper rolls, pieces of ripped cardboard, stuff like that. I know that my buns don't really eat cardboard and paper, though. That might not be a good idea if yours do, but it works well for us. I sprinkle their pellets and a dried herb/flower mix in it for them to forrage.

I'm actually not giving her any treats yet. Our vet recommended to wait a bit before giving her treats and veggies besides greens. So she gets green lettuce twice a day, about a quarter cup of pellets, and unlimited hay. The pellets are Oxbow. We tried the Natural Selective and she wouldn't eat them. For hay, we do mostly Timothy with a little alfalfa and orchard grass.

I'm a voice CART Provider (for 9 years) and currently testing for my CVR. I was on a CART job last night with another captioner and we were talking about this. He's in California and just made the switch to voice. He said that he's noticing a lot of people are switching to voice, which is great to hear! And I hear there's a lot of work in Californina.

Being a voice writer (voice stenographer, if you prefer), of course I'm going to advocate for it. I really love it. Learning the steno machine sounds HARD, but there's also a lot of work and education that goes into learning voice as well. I say go for it! There's no reason you can't do both, right? Some days maybe you feel like using a machine and some days a mask. I don't think it's a bad idea to have as many skills in your toolbelt as you can.
